Situated in the south of Malta is the village of Zurrieq. The beautifully preserved architecture, archaeological and historical sites of the village make Zurrieq accommodation a great place to unwind and experience the rich history and culture of Malta.
Zurrieq accommodation comes in a variety of sizes to suit all your Malta holiday requirements. Families on a Malta holiday can choose between spacious self-catering villas, or experience the luxury and comfort of a Zurrieq castle, which is perfect for large families or groups of friends.
Although Zurrieq villas and holiday rentals are surrounded by barren, windswept land, the island of Malta is relatively small which means you are never far from beautiful beaches and other attractions. Nearby are the resorts of Blue Grotto, Pretty Bay, Ghar Lapsi, St Thomas Bay where you can enjoy swimming, sailing and snorkeling. The historic sites of Hagar Qim, Mnajdra and Ghar Hassan will fascinate history buffs, while the unspoilt rugged coastline will appeal to cyclists and hikers. Other Malta attractions include the Phoenician tombs in Zurrieq, the UNESCO World Heritage City of Valletta, which is best explored on foot, as well as the island of Gozo, which can be reached by ferry and makes an excellent day trip.
